Composite roof inspection services involve a thorough examination of a roof made primarily from composite materials, which are commonly used in residential properties. These inspections typically include checking for signs of damage, such as cracks, curling, or missing shingles, as well as assessing the overall condition of the roofing surface. Inspectors look for issues that could lead to leaks or structural problems, ensuring that the roof remains functional and protective over time. This process helps homeowners identify potential problems early, before they develop into costly repairs or replacements.
One of the main benefits of a composite roof inspection is identifying common issues like water infiltration, shingle deterioration, or damage caused by weather events such as hail or strong winds. Detecting these problems early can prevent water leaks, mold growth, and further structural damage to the home. Inspections can also reveal areas where the roof may be nearing the end of its lifespan, allowing homeowners to plan for maintenance or replacement proactively. Regular inspections are especially valuable for homes that have experienced severe weather or show signs of aging, helping to maintain the integrity of the roof and the safety of the property.

The overview below groups typical Composite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Clarksburg,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, local pros charge between $250 and $600 for routine inspections and minor repairs on composite roofs. Many projects fall within this range, especially for straightforward issues like small cracks or damaged shingles. Larger, more complex repairs can exceed this range but are less common.
Partial Repairs - For moderate repairs such as replacing sections of damaged decking or addressing localized leaks, costs usually range from $600 to $1,500. Many projects in Clarksburg and nearby areas are completed within this band, depending on the extent of damage.
Full Roof Inspection - A comprehensive inspection of the entire composite roof typically costs between $150 and $400. This is a common price range for routine assessments performed by local service providers to identify potential issues early.
Full Roof Replacement - Larger, more involved projects like full roof replacements can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Many projects reach the mid-range, but high-end installations or complex designs can push costs higher.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a composite roof inspection? A composite roof inspection involves a thorough assessment of the roof's condition, including the materials, structure, and potential areas of concern, conducted by experienced local contractors in Clarksburg, MD.
Why should I have my composite roof inspected? Regular inspections help identify issues early, such as damage or wear, allowing for timely repairs that can extend the roof's lifespan and prevent costly future repairs.
What signs indicate my composite roof might need an inspection? Visible signs like missing or cracked shingles, water stains on ceilings, or granule loss can suggest the need for a professional assessment by local service providers.
How do local contractors perform a composite roof inspection? They typically examine the roof surface, check for damage or deterioration, assess flashing and seals, and evaluate the overall integrity of the roofing system.
